About 2004 Lifts - Fork in New York

A 2004 fork lift can still be a practical material-handling machine if the fundamentals are right: capacity, mast configuration, fuel type, and overall hydraulic condition. In this class, buyers typically compare cushion-tire warehouse units, heavier pneumatic-tire models for mixed indoor and outdoor use, and propane, gasoline, diesel, or electric power depending on the application. Common capacity points range from roughly 3,000 to 5,000 pounds for standard warehouse forklifts, with larger units stepping well beyond 10,000 pounds for steel, lumber, machinery, and yard work. For New York operations, floor condition, dock height, aisle width, and cold-weather starting performance matter just as much as the name on the counterweight.

The first buying decision is usually lift capacity versus load center. A forklift rated at 4,000 or 5,000 pounds may handle less once longer forks, side shift, fork positioners, clamps, or a tall mast are added. Buyers should look closely at the data plate, maximum lift height, collapsed mast height, and free lift if the machine will work inside trailers, containers, or low-clearance buildings. Two-stage and three-stage masts are common in this segment, and side shift is one of the most valuable options because it speeds pallet handling and reduces trailer contact. Fork length, carriage class, back tilt, and any signs of mast channel wear or cylinder seepage are worth checking before comparing price alone.

Powertrain and tire setup tell you where the machine fits best. LP gas forklifts are common because they refuel quickly and work well in warehouse and dock service, but buyers should verify regulator condition, starting quality, and whether the unit loads up or floods when shut down. Electric units can be a strong fit for indoor work if battery age, charger compatibility, and run time are acceptable. Diesel units are more common in heavier outdoor applications. Cushion tires are typical on smooth concrete and in tighter turning environments, while pneumatic tires are better for broken pavement, gravel, lumber yards, and uneven surfaces. On older lifts, service history matters more than paint. Hour meter accuracy, transmission engagement, steer axle play, brake response, lift and tilt speed, chain condition, and dry hydraulic cylinders all deserve a close inspection.

For a buyer comparing 2004 fork lifts, the best value usually comes from matching the truck to the real job instead of buying on rated capacity alone. A warehouse handling standard pallets may need a compact 5,000-pound cushion-tire unit with side shift and an 80-inch collapsed height. A fabrication shop or building supply operation may need more fork length, pneumatic tires, and a higher-capacity chassis. Parts support is still strong for many established brands, but older forklifts should be evaluated as working assets, not just low-cost equipment. If the mast, hydraulics, transmission, cooling system, and fuel system are sound, a 2004 forklift can still deliver solid service in shipping, receiving, manufacturing, warehousing, agriculture, and municipal applications.

Frequently Asked Questions

What should I check first on a used 2004 fork lift?

Start with the data plate, actual lift capacity, mast type, and overall hydraulic condition. Then inspect for chain wear, mast rail damage, cylinder leaks, steer axle looseness, brake performance, transmission engagement, and cold-start behavior. On an older forklift, a strong mast and hydraulic system usually matter more than cosmetics, because those are the components that directly affect safe lifting and daily uptime.

Is a propane fork lift a good choice for warehouse work?

A propane forklift is often a good fit for warehouse and dock use because refueling is fast and the machines typically offer good run time and consistent power. The main checks are fuel system condition, regulator function, clean starting, and proper shutdown behavior. Buyers should also confirm that the propane tank bracket, lines, and fittings are in safe operating condition and that the engine does not run rich, flood, or hesitate under load.

How do I choose the right mast for a fork lift?

Choose the mast based on both maximum lift height and lowered height. A forklift may need enough lift to stack racking while still collapsing low enough to enter trailers, pass through doors, or clear low beams. Free lift is important in trailers and containers because it lets the forks rise before the mast extends upward. Side shift is highly desirable with any mast because it improves pallet placement and reduces handling time.

What is the difference between cushion tires and pneumatic tires on a fork lift?

Cushion tires are best for smooth indoor concrete, tighter aisles, and dock work where compact dimensions and a smaller turning radius are important. Pneumatic tires are better for outdoor yards, rough pavement, gravel, and mixed-surface use because they provide better ground clearance and a smoother ride. The right tire type affects stability, traction, operator comfort, and how well the machine fits your facility.

Can a 2004 fork lift still be a reliable buy?

Yes, if it has been maintained and the major systems are sound. Many older forklifts remain productive because their basic design is durable and parts support is still available for major brands. Reliability depends less on age alone and more on service history, actual hours, hydraulic condition, cooling system health, transmission performance, and whether the forklift has been matched to the correct application throughout its life.
